On 7 September 2023, the Polar Connection Vision 2030 webinars delved deeper into the latest insights shaping the future of one of the four sections of the European Data Gateways, namely the North Atlantic and Arctic section.

Highlights from the webinars include exploration of arguments underpinning the necessity for a resilient submarine cable system in the Arctic Ocean, and the actual feasibility of this ambitious endeavour. Distinguished speakers illustrated how the Arctic route offers the potential to improve and secure backbone connectivity for Europe and our partners in Asia and North America. To this should be added, the multiple benefits and opportunities such a route will offer to the scientific community.

The perspectives and insights shared during the webinars are invaluable contribution shaping the future of Arctic Connectivity.
